Just make sure you are not travelling during a bad time -- when bad weather happens in some places. Hurricane season usually lasts throughout late summer until fall in Florida and in some states too. Best time to come is spring to early summer, IMO. Unless you don't mind coming during the winter months.. which is like your summer months in Australia, right?
